Aço de Manganês High Mn13: Propriedades, Características, e aplicativos
Visão geral
High manganese steel Mn13 is a top choice for wear-resistant materials. É ideal para aplicações que envolvem fortes impactos e alta pressão. Sua capacidade única de sofrer endurecimento por trabalho o torna superior a outros materiais. Sob forte impacto ou estresse, sua dureza superficial aumenta significativamente (de HB200 a HB500+), creating a durable wear-resistant layer while maintaining toughness inside.

Composição Química
| Elemento | Contente (%) |
|---|---|
| Carbono (C) | 0.90–1,20 |
| Silício (E) | 0.30–0.80 |
| Manganês (Mn) | 11.00–14.00 |
| Fósforo (P) | ≤0,035 |
| Enxofre (S) | ≤0,030 |

Padrões
MN13, Também conhecido como Hadfield Steel, adheres to various international standards, incluindo:
- China: GB/T5680-2010
- EUA: ASTM A128
- Japão: JISG5131
- ISO: ISO13521:1999(E)
Processing Techniques
- Corte
- Corte Plasma: Underwater plasma cutting ensures smooth cuts with minimal heat-affected zones.
- Corte de Chama: Use a cutting trolley and adjust to a neutral flame for optimal results.
- Soldagem
- Use small-diameter electrodes (3–3.5 mm) with multiple layers and passes.
- Clean surfaces thoroughly before welding and hammer the weld after each layer to prevent cracking.
- Cooling with water can improve welding quality.
